Rubric for Medication Administration

The student must demonstrate safe, accurate medication administration.

Satisfactory

· Able to independently perform medication administration meeting facility timeliness

· Utilizes the “rights” of medication administration

· Able to apply theory and specific patient information (i.e. VS, lab results) to medication administration

· Consistently and promptly responds to pump alarms

· Consistently checks compatibility of IV solutions/medications

· Consistently and successfully uses two patient identifiers with every medication administration

· Consistently asks patient about allergies with every medication administration

· Has knowledge about typical dose and rationale for each medication administered

· Able to independently and accurately document medication in the EHR in a timely manner

Needs Improvement

· Performs medication administration but needs occasional prompts/reminders

· Seeks assistance in application of specific patient information and theory to medication administration

· Responds to pumps with occasional prompts and reminders

· Needs occasional prompt to check IV compatibility

· Needs one prompt/reminder to use
two patient identifiers and/or to chart meds

Unsatisfactory

· Does not successfully perform medication administration and other nursing skills

· Does not seek assistance to improve

· Needs frequent guidance in application of specific patient information/theory to medication administration

· Needs frequent prompts/reminders to respond to pump alarms

· Needs frequent prompts to check IV compatibility

· Fails to use two patient identifiers on more than one occasion

· Fails to ask patient about allergies

· Frequent prompts to document medications in the EHR

· Fails to accurately calculate medication dose +/or rate
